Hi, a lump all of a sudden appears on my forehead above my eyebrow last month. It went away and it appears again today. I appreciate any advice. actually I had some stress today on my job and I just noticed that the lump appears on my forehead. is this related to stress? thank you so much
Hello, A lump on your forehead is unlikely to be caused by stress. I would tell that the lump is more related to blocking of your glands on your eyebrow. There are different types of glands in the eyebrow that brings out secretion, like the glands in your face and other parts of the body which brings out sebum, sweat etc. If there is a blockage of this glands it can cause swelling.
It's not a serious condition although if it's recurrent a consult should be done. For now you can try using topical creams such as clindamycin or bacitracin as most of the times blockage is followed by infection by the normal bacteria found in our skin. The condition is usually self limited and will go on its own. If it cause worsening symptoms like headache, visual complaints or if its recurrent consult your physician for finding other causes.
